Smart Digital Torque Socket is a high-precision torque measurement tool that integrates torque sensor, data acquisition, data display, and wireless data transmission functions. It can display torque values in real-time during bolt tightening and provide high-precision torque measurement and control capabilities.

Major global manufacturers of Smart Digital Torque Socket include Jiangsu Canete Machinery Manufacturing, Shanghai Paitai Industrial, New World Technology, NORNS, Wuhan Zhonghong Precision Machinery, Suowo Hydraulic Technology(Shanghai), Shanghai Dejin Hydraulic Tools, RAD Torque Systems, Torque Tools Inc., among others.
